ingredients

  • 6 loaves ciabatta
  • 12 cup mayonnaise
  • 12 cup Dijon mustard
  • 18 slices provolone cheese
  • chilli rubbed pork
  • 8 pepperoncini peppers, thinkly sliced
  • 12 slices black forest ham (or leftover ham)
  • 2 cups bread, and butter pickle slices

directions

  • Slice crusts off top and bottom of each ciabatta loaf, leaving the sides.
  • Cut loaves in half horizontally.
  • Spread a thin layer of mayonnaise and mustard on bread.
  • Layer half of the loaf with a slice of cheese, a thin layer of pork, a layer of peperoncini, a second slice of cheese, 2 slices of ham, a layer of pickles, and a third slice of cheese.
  • Top with remaining half of loaf, spread side down and repeat.
  • Preheat a grill pan over medium high heat. Place pannini in pan. Peace a heavy pan on top, pressing down, and cook until browned, about 4 minutes. Flip, pressing down, and cook until browned, about 4 minutes.
  • Serve immediately and enjoy!
